6,000 lbs of food on 1/10th acre - Los Angeles - Urban Homestead News Link  •  Food
6,000 lbs of food on 1/10th acre - Los Angeles - Urban Homestead
11-22-2013  •  youtube 
Over 6,000 pounds of food per year, on 1/10 acre located in LA. The Dervaes family grows over 400 species of plants, 4,300 pounds of vegetable food, 900 chicken and 1,000 duck eggs, 25 lbs of honey, plus seasonal fruits throughout the year.  Read Full Story
